I have a mac OS 10.8.2 and I want to download office mac 2008 however it is a cd rom and my comp doesnt have a cd rom. Is there any way to still download it without buying an external disk drive? more

Dec 27, 2012 8:13 PM in response to jannsime1by Kappy,Yes, if you have access to another computer with an optical drive. You can connect the two computers via your home network and use File Sharing to transfer the installer to your HDD. You can also use:
DVD or CD sharing- Using Remote Disc
Remote Disc, Migration, or Remote Install Mac OS X and wireless 802.11n networks

Dec 27, 2012 8:21 PM in response to jannsime1by Barney-15E,You might check to see if Microsoft has a download. There's one for 2011, but I'm not sure about the older version. With the 2011 version, you can activate it with a valid code, so you might be able to do the same.
